Great Apartment

Great apartment in Glover Park, which is walking distance to campus (about 15-20 min walk). Street parking. Washer and dryer in basement. Dishwasher in unit. Spacious, true one bedroom. Walking distance to Whole Foods, Glover Park, bars and restaurants. Great management- if I have a leak or anything that isn't working they will take over and get it taken care of very quickly.

Glover Park Reviews

58 reviews
The neighborhood is very quiet and seems to be family-oriented. There are always people out on a walk. Everything seems to be very safe.
The only downside is poor public transportation access. There are no metro stops nearby. There is one bus (D2) right outside, which goes to Dupont Circle. Buses like 30, 31, and 33 are also accessible by a short walk. Not bad overall, but can make commutes somewhat long.
I love Glover Park. It is much more neighborhood than city. Wisconsin Ave has a good selection of restaurants and shops in walking distance. It's about a mile downhill to Georgetown University. Coming home, that mile is uphill! Decent bus service, no metro service at all. Uber has it covered very well.
Glover Park is an extremely safe area. It has tons of food options along with basically anything else you could need. The downside is it is not near any public transportation and the cost of living is veru high. It is extremely popular for young adults to move their after college graudation. Definitely a young, fun enviroment.
Glover Park feels like a small town in a big city. Full of quiet side streets that are great for walking/running. I feel very safe riding my bike to campus, to DuPont, to Georgetown, etc. It's a mix of students and young families, so I feel very safe.
Excellent neighborhood, quiet and close to short trail walks that take you directly into nature. Although there is no metro, there is a well-connected bus system. Trader Joe's and Safeway are both not too far and school is a good walk.
Safe area, walking distance to necessities, not a lot of noise, mix of young professionals right out of college and young families, decent amount of restaurants
Cozy suburb within DC. Lots of young families so neighbors are nice. Nice restaurants in the area, but not a very lively nightlife per se.
Easy access to whole foods, fast casual restaurants, good bar scene (Town Hall, Mad Fox, Bread Soda), Monday night trivia at Bread Soda!
